Approximation Property of the Stationary Stokes Equations with the Periodic Boundary Condition
In this paper, we will consider the stationary Stokes equations with the periodic boundary condition and we will study approximation property of the solutions by using the properties of the Fourier series. Finally, we will discuss that our estimation for approximate solutions is optimal.
